My company has been a loyal displayer at every ACS Homeshow in Raleigh, NC since 2009.  We have displayed in the Raleigh Convention Center at nine consectutive shows.  We have spent over $25,000.00 with this company. We informed them that we could not afford to do the Spring Show this year, and instead of showing us any loyalty or having any concern about our company they sent us a letter saying that they would be seeking legal action against me.  The letter is very threatening.  They threaten to ruin my credit and cost me alot more money with litigation expenses and attorney fees.  

I had planned on continuing to do business with them in the future, but after having endured the ugly phone calls and harsh treatment by the employees at ACS, I will never display at their shows again.   

When we initially started doing the show with ACS, we recieved a lot of leads for work.  Over the years, the response has been less and less.  We tried to talk with them about changes that we felt would help the show.  They were not receptive, at all.  Instead, we were told if we didn't like the way they did things, we didn't have to be there.  In retrospect, we should have realized then what kind of people with whom we were dealing.

Beware when dealing with these people.

#1 UPDATE Employee

The Full Story

AUTHOR: ACS Management - ()

POSTED: Tuesday, March 11, 2014

This client fails to state that they first emailed ACS on 1/27/14, approximately three weeks before the home show to tell us that they were not paying. Their contract clearly states that they can cancel at any time prior to 11/1/2013. Once the cancel date passes, we commit our clients money to advertising and producing the home show. If any client wants to cancel their participation in a show, we simply ask them to cancel prior to the contract cancel date. After that time, their money has been committed and will be spent. We cannot run a successful business and produce results for our clients if everyone could cancel their contract for any reason at any time.

Additionally, we always look into client suggestions and often implement their ideas. It would be impossible to act on every suggestion made by a client but we do our best to implement ideas that we feel could benefit many of our clients.

We have thousands of happy clients, many of which have written testimonials. You can find scores of testimonials on our website.
